I went out there by myself in May 2017. I arranged permission to enter the ranch via Don Schmitt, founder of the Roswell UFO Museum; although there are no “No Trespassing” signs on the gate. It takes about 1.5hrs to drive out there from Roswell, the roads are great, even the dirt ones with the exception of the last mile. You don’t necessarily need a 4x4, just something that will have good ground clearance, I had a 2x4 Nissan Frontier, the large wheels made it easy to get over the rocks on the last mile of the trail; you can always walk it.
There is cell reception in certain areas of the site, I even did a live FB video; it is very spotty though. I noted the areas of cell reception just in case I needed to make a call. I would also recommend some kind of GPS tracker like a Spot, that way you can have a programmed message if you get in trouble or just to check in with someone to tell then you’re ok.
It is an incredibly desolate quiet place despite a few cows and farm buildings you’ll see in the distance. I spent about 3 hrs walking the site and collected some soil to take home. It was very windy.
